The Larkspur migration runner uses a dedicated service account so zero-downtime schema changes can run without human credentials. Each migration executes in two phases: expand (additive changes) then contract (cleanup after traffic drains). The runner authenticates against the internal Coppermine coordination service to acquire a migration lock before either phase begins. Maintainers should rotate the account quarterly and update the vault entry. The current key for the Coppermine lock service is provided below.

app token of kahif-tawif = qvz15-i12BqYS9lsDqEa1

# Budget Request — Orrinfield Lab Expansion (Managers Only)

This page summarises the capital request submitted by the Orrinfield research group. The ask covers new test rigs, two additional analysts, and facility upgrades, phased over eighteen months. Finance has reviewed the figures and flagged no material concerns. Heads of department should submit comments before month end. The confidential planning note is appended below.

management briefing: Project Ulavan slips by two quarters because of the staffing delay.

**Q: Why does Quillpress strip raw HTML in PR previews?**

Sanitization runs before rendering; the allowlist is intentionally small. Don't approve changes that bypass the sanitizer stage — extend the allowlist instead. Table and footnote extensions are enabled by default. The full pipeline stages and allowlist config are documented on the internal page below.

runbook for badug-kadup: https://confluence.zemvarlabs.internal/projects/browse/display/projects/bd1b

## Deployment: Rate Limiting

The Brindlegate gateway enforces per-client token buckets at the edge. Limits apply before auth, so unauthenticated floods never reach upstream services. Changes require a rolling restart of the gateway pods; limits are not hot-reloaded. Do not raise the burst ceiling without sign-off from the platform rotation, since Quillhaven's billing exporter shares the same upstream pool. The current production limits are as follows.

deployment values, yageg-tawif:
ULAAEL_LOG_LEVEL=info
ULAAEL_METRICS_HOST=metrics.ulaael.tolvaqworks.corp
ULAAEL_POOL_SIZE=8